An alkane withmolecularmass 72 formed only one substitution product .Suggest a structure for thealkane .

Answer»

Solution :Letthemolecularformula of thealkane be`C_(n)H_(2n+2).`
Molecular mass of thealane `nC+(2n+2)H`
`=nxx12+(2n+2)xx1`
`=14n+2`
`thus,14n+2=72`
or `14n=72-2=70`
SO, `n=(70)/(14)=5`
thus , the molecularformulaof thealkane is `C_(5)H_(12). ` It canthavethreeisomers .
